Product Features

Excellent corrosion resistance
A dense and stable oxide film (TiO₂) will naturally form on the surface of our products. The thickness of this film is about 2-5 nanometers, which can effectively block the corrosion of media such as acid, alkali, salt water, and chloride ions. Compared with the local corrosion problem of stainless steel flanges in highly corrosive environments (such as seawater, chloride solutions, hydrochloric acid gas, etc.), Gr2 Titanium Forged Flange hardly corrode in long-term operation, and are especially suitable for highly corrosive scenes such as petrochemicals and marine engineering.
Lightweight material
The density of titanium is only 4.51 g/cm³, which is about 60% of steel, but its specific strength (strength/density) is much higher than that of copper, stainless steel, and carbon steel. Our products can withstand higher mechanical loads and internal pressures of pipelines without increasing the weight of the structure.


Good thermal stability
Titanium can withstand continuous high temperatures of up to 600°C at normal pressure, and there is no significant performance degradation at high temperatures. Titanium Flange have a low thermal expansion coefficient (about 8.6 × 10⁻⁶/K) in high temperature environments, which means that they are not easy to deform, leak, or fatigue damage under thermal stress.
Long service life
Due to its excellent chemical stability and mechanical durability, the service life of our products in harsh environments generally exceeds 20 years. Compared with the 5-10 year life of ordinary carbon steel flanges, Gr2 Titanium Forged Flange can maintain structural stability under the combined effects of strong corrosion, moisture, high temperature, high pressure, etc., which can greatly reduce the replacement frequency and operation and maintenance costs, and the total cost of long-term use is lower.

FAQ
Q: What is a Gr2 Titanium Forged Flange?
A: A Gr2 Titanium Forged Flange is a forged or cast component used to connect pipes, valves, pumps, and other equipment in piping systems. Made from titanium or titanium alloys, it provides high strength, corrosion resistance, and lightweight performance.
Q: Why is titanium used for flange manufacturing?
A: Titanium offers exceptional corrosion resistance, especially to seawater, chlorine, and acidic environments. It is also strong yet lightweight, making it ideal for high-performance and corrosive applications.
Q: How does a titanium flange compare to a stainless steel flange?
A: Titanium flanges are lighter and significantly more corrosion-resistant than stainless steel. However, they are more expensive and are typically used where performance and longevity outweigh cost concerns.
Q: Are Gr2 Titanium Forged Flanges suitable for high-temperature environments?
A: Yes, certain titanium alloys (like Grade 5) can operate effectively at temperatures up to 400–600°C, depending on the application. However, for extreme heat, specific material selection is essential.
Q: How are titanium flanges installed?
A: Titanium flanges are typically welded or bolted into piping systems. Proper handling and compatible fasteners (often titanium or non-corrosive alloys) are crucial to avoid galvanic corrosion.
Q: What are the dimensional standards for Gr2 Titanium Forged Flanges?
A: Gr2 Titanium Forged Flanges are manufactured according to standards such as ASME B16.5, DIN, EN1092, and JIS, depending on the application and region.
